Taoiseach condemns forced landing of Ryanair flight by Belarusian president to detain journalist
Belarus police detain journalist Raman Pratasevich, in Belarus. Photo: AP
Taoiseach Micheál Martin has called the forced landing of a Ryanair plane by the Belarusian president in order to detain a journalist as "unprecedented."
The forced landing of a passenger plane in Belarus today to detain a journalist is absolutely unacceptable.
